Central Stadium (Russian: Центральный стадион, Tsentralnyi Stadion) is a multi-purpose stadium in Astrakhan, Russia. It is used mostly for football matches and is the home stadium of Volgar Astrakhan. The stadium holds 21,500 people, all seated.

The venue hosted 2015 Russian Cup Final between Lokomotiv Moscow and Kuban Krasnodar.[2] This was the first time Central Stadium had been chosen to host Russian Cup final.
